The evolution of casinos tracing their history through time
The Origins of Gambling
The history of casinos can be traced back thousands of years, with evidence of gambling activities found in ancient civilizations like Mesopotamia and China. The earliest forms of gambling included rudimentary games of chance, often involving dice made from bone or wood. As societies developed, so did their gambling practices, evolving into more structured games. This set the stage for the emergence of organized gambling venues, laying the foundation for modern casinos. In Ancient Rome, gambling was prevalent in society, with various games being played in public spaces. The Romans took gambling seriously, even establishing legal regulations to govern it. This legal framework allowed for the establishment of dedicated areas for gaming, which can be seen as early iterations of modern casinos. These venues became social hubs where individuals could partake in various games and relax in a vibrant atmosphere.
By the Middle Ages, gambling had spread throughout Europe, with the rise of card games becoming particularly popular. This era also saw the establishment of the first known gambling houses in Italy, specifically in Venice. These establishments marked the transition from informal gambling to a more organized approach, leading to the birth of the casino concept we recognize today.
The Rise of Formal Casinos
The 17th century marked a significant turning point in the evolution of casinos, especially with the establishment of the first official casino, the Ridotto, in Venice in 1638. This venue was a government-operated gambling house aimed at controlling the gaming activities of its citizens. It offered a variety of games, including card games and a form of early roulette. The Ridotto’s establishment reflected a growing acceptance of gambling as a legitimate pastime, paving the way for the development of future casinos across Europe.
In the subsequent centuries, casinos began to flourish throughout Europe. France emerged as a focal point for gambling, with establishments like the Casino de Spa in Belgium and the first real casino in Monte Carlo in the 19th century. These venues attracted the elite and wealthy, serving as luxurious escapes for high-stakes gambling. The design and decor of these casinos became extravagant, featuring ornate architecture and lavish interiors, symbolizing wealth and opulence.
The 20th century saw the expansion of casinos beyond Europe, particularly with the rise of Las Vegas in the United States. The legalization of gambling in Nevada in 1931 set the stage for the rapid growth of casinos in the region. Las Vegas transformed into a glittering oasis of entertainment, attracting millions of tourists annually. This evolution marked a pivotal moment in casino history, as gaming became integrated into popular culture, leading to the establishment of themed hotels and entertainment complexes.
The Digital Revolution in Gaming
As technology advanced, the gambling industry began to undergo a significant transformation with the introduction of online casinos in the late 1990s. The advent of the internet allowed players to engage in gambling activities from the comfort of their homes, opening up a new world of possibilities. Online casinos offered a wide variety of games, ranging from traditional table games to innovative slot machines, making gambling more accessible than ever before. Online gambling platforms also introduced features such as live dealer games, where players could interact with real dealers through video streaming. This created an immersive gaming experience reminiscent of brick-and-mortar casinos, effectively bridging the gap between the virtual and physical worlds of gambling. The convenience of online gambling has contributed to its rapid growth, attracting a diverse audience worldwide.
Moreover, advancements in mobile technology have further revolutionized the casino landscape. Mobile gaming applications have made it possible for players to gamble on-the-go, with many online casinos optimizing their platforms for mobile devices. This accessibility has led to an explosion in the popularity of mobile casinos, as more individuals choose to play their favorite games from smartphones and tablets, significantly influencing the future of the gaming industry.
The Current Landscape of Casinos
Today, the casino industry continues to evolve, incorporating advanced technology such as virtual reality (VR) and artificial intelligence (AI) to enhance the player experience. VR technology allows players to immerse themselves in simulated casino environments, creating a unique and engaging experience that traditional casinos cannot replicate. This innovation has the potential to reshape how players interact with games, offering a new frontier in casino entertainment.
AI is also playing a crucial role in the modern casino landscape, particularly in the area of customer service and game development. Intelligent algorithms analyze player behavior, enabling casinos to tailor their offerings and promotions to individual preferences. This personalized approach enhances the gaming experience and helps retain players, contributing to the overall growth of the industry.
Furthermore, the rise of cryptocurrencies has introduced new payment methods within the casino ecosystem. Many online casinos are now accepting cryptocurrencies as a form of payment, offering players added privacy and security. This trend reflects the ongoing transformation of the industry, as casinos adapt to changing technologies and player preferences in a rapidly evolving digital age.
